Marks & Spencer

Marks & Spencer is an international retailer with its headquarters in the United Kingdom. The company sells clothes, food, and home products in the UK and internationally. Its business is divided into two parts that are the UK retail business and the international business. Michael Marks and Thomas Spencer founded the company on September 28,1884. The company's stock is traded on the London Stock Exchange.

Marks and Spencer is known for its long-standing commitment to quality, particularly in the realm of customer service. In fact it was one of the first retailers to let customers return items that did not meet their expectations. The company's commitment to quality has earned it a reputation for being an excellent place to purchase clothing and food.

The early days of M&S were marked by its low prices, practicality and the sale of foodstuffs and household goods. It also provided a comfortable shopping environment, with large display areas and the ability to choose items on your own. M&S expanded its product range with the increase in income, including more luxurious clothes and home goods.

M&S announced a major revamp of its stores after the 2008 recession. The company would eliminate a number of non-profitable stores and improve its online offerings. Its aim was to improve customer experience and draw new customers.

Homebase

Homebase is a gardening and home improvement company located in the UK. Home Retail Group owned it prior to when Wesfarmers purchased it in 2010. Wesfarmers tried to rebrand their stores under the name of Bunnings Warehouse but it was unsuccessful and the company was sold to the restructuring firm Hilco in the year 2018. Hilco changed the store's branding with the new name and logo and focused on interior design and removed the tool focus of Bunnings.
